Steel Detailing vs Structural Steel Detailing: What’s the Difference?

Steel Detailing and structural steel detailing

Introduction

In the construction and structural engineering industry, the terms steel detailing and structural steel detailing are often used interchangeably. While they are closely related, they are not exactly the same. Understanding the distinction can help architects, engineers, fabricators, contractors, and project owners choose the right detailing services for their projects.

Structural steel detailing is a specialised branch of steel detailing that focuses on the primary load-bearing framework of buildings, bridges, industrial plants, warehouses, stadiums, and other infrastructure. Steel detailing, on the other hand, is a broader discipline that also includes miscellaneous and architectural steel components.

What Is Steel Detailing?

Steel detailing is the process of producing accurate fabrication and erection drawings for steel components used in construction projects. These detailed drawings ensure every steel element is manufactured, assembled, and installed according to the engineer’s design specifications.

Steel detailing acts as the bridge between structural design and fabrication. Detailers convert engineering calculations into practical shop drawings that fabricators and erectors use throughout the construction process.

A complete steel detailing package typically includes:

  • Shop drawings.
  • Erection drawings.
  • Fabrication drawings.
  • Material take-offs.
  • Bolt schedules.
  • Weld details.
  • CNC files.
  • Assembly drawings.
  • Bills of Materials (BOM).

Steel detailing covers a wide range of steel products, including structural, miscellaneous, and architectural steel.

What Is Structural Steel Detailing?

Structural steel detailing is a specialised discipline that focuses exclusively on the primary structural framework of a building or industrial facility.

These members are responsible for supporting the loads of the structure and transferring them safely to the foundation.

Structural steel detailing generally includes:

  • Columns.
  • Beams.
  • Girders.
  • Trusses.
  • Bracing systems.
  • Base plates.
  • Gusset plates.
  • Connection plates.
  • Anchor bolts.
  • Structural connections.

Every structural steel member must be accurately detailed to ensure proper fabrication, transportation, and installation while complying with project specifications and applicable design codes.

Types of Steel Detailing

1. Structural Steel Detailing

This service focuses on the building’s structural skeleton and includes:

  • Beam detailing.
  • Column detailing.
  • Truss detailing.
  • Bracing detailing.
  • Steel connection detailing.
  • Base plate detailing.
  • Anchor bolt detailing.

2. Miscellaneous Steel Detailing

Miscellaneous steel detailing covers non-primary steel components such as:

  • Staircases.
  • Handrails.
  • Guardrails.
  • Ladders.
  • Platforms.
  • Catwalks.
  • Pipe supports
  • Equipment supports.
  • Roof access systems.

3. Architectural Steel Detailing

Architectural steel detailing emphasises aesthetics as well as functionality.

Common applications include:

  • Decorative staircases
  • Feature steelwork
  • Glass support systems
  • Architectural canopies
  • Façade support framing
  • Ornamental steel

Deliverables of Structural Steel Detailing Services

Professional structural steel detailing services typically include:

  • Structural shop drawings.
  • Steel fabrication drawings.
  • Steel erection drawings.
  • Connection detailing.
  • Anchor bolt plans.
  • Base plate details.
  • Assembly drawings.
  • Single-part drawings.
  • General arrangement drawings.
  • Bolt schedules.
  • Weld schedules.
  • Material take-offs.
  • Bills of Materials (BOM).
  • CNC data files.
  • NC1/DSTV files.

Software Used for Structural Steel Detailing

Modern detailers rely on advanced software to improve precision and collaboration.

Popular platforms include:

  • Tekla Structures.
  • Autodesk Advance Steel.
  • Autodesk Revit.
  • SDS2.
  • AutoCAD.
  • Navisworks.
  • BIM 360.

These tools enable clash detection, automated drawing generation, material tracking, and BIM coordination.
